highway condition
On part of my trip, I'll be traveling from Amarillo, TX to Great Sand Dunes in Colorado. Does anyone know the current conditions on I-25 from Raton to Walsenburg?
My Googlemap shows construction on that stretch of highway.
I'll be in my 45' coach with a toad.
First week of August

We just traveled that area yesterday (7/6/25). The right lane from the top of Raton Pass has been resurfaced and is in great condition. The right lane north of Trinidad to Ludlow was also resurfaced. It did not look like they were getting ready to do anything on the left lane yet and it's in pretty bad condition in some areas. That could change since they are trying to finish up before the snow season starts.
Southbound in Colorado is very similar with only the right lane resurfaced so far. On the downhill side going southbound in New Mexico, Raton Pass has some very bad spots before getting into Raton. Not long though.
